2026 Jeep Compass DTCM Software Update for Depleted Battery

A Technical Service Bulletin (TSB 08-048-26) addresses a potential issue in 2026 Jeep Compass vehicles where a Drivetrain Control Module (DTCM) software fault can lead to a depleted battery and a no-start condition. The TSB outlines a software update procedure.

Stellantis has released Technical Service Bulletin (TSB) 08-048-26, also known as Rapid Service Update (RSU) 26-026, to address a software-related concern in certain 2026 Jeep Compass vehicles. This bulletin specifically applies to vehicles built for the South America market, manufactured on or after April 14, 2025 (MDH 0414XX) and on or before February 06, 2026 (MDH 0206XX).

The TSB outlines a procedure to inspect and potentially reprogram the Drivetrain Control Module (DTCM) with the latest available software. This update aims to resolve instances where owners might experience a Jeep Compass depleted battery.

Symptoms

Owners of affected 2026 Jeep Compass vehicles may experience the following symptom:

  • "Vehicle does not start due to a depleted battery."

Cause

The root cause of this issue is identified as a fault within the DTCM Software.

Important Warnings

Several critical notes are provided for technicians performing this update:

  • Battery Voltage: Install a battery charger to ensure the battery voltage does not drop below 13.2 volts during the flash process. Do not allow the charging voltage to climb above 13.5 volts.
  • Flash Interruption: If the flash process is interrupted or aborted for any reason, the flash should be restarted.
  • DID-I or DID-A: After applying this TSB, it is not necessary to send DID-I or DID-A.

Diagnosis

Before proceeding with the repair, technicians must use a Scan Tool (wiTECH) with appropriate Diagnostic Procedures. This involves verifying all related systems are functioning as designed. If any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s) or symptom conditions, other than the Jeep Compass depleted battery issue, are present, they must be recorded and addressed before proceeding with this bulletin.

Technicians will also check if the customer's vehicle VIN is listed in the VIP system or the RSU VIN list. If the VIN is on the list, the repair should be performed. If a vehicle not on the VIN list exhibits the symptom, the repair procedure should still be followed.

Repair Procedure Summary

The repair involves inspecting the DTCM software level and, if necessary, reprogramming it. The general steps are:

  1. VIN Check: Verify if the vehicle is on the RSU VIN list.
  2. Software Level Check: If on the RSU list, check if the DTCM already has the latest software. If it does, the bulletin is considered complete, and labor operation 18-19-07-C1 (Inspect Software Level) is used.
  3. Reprogramming: If the DTCM does not have the latest software, it must be reprogrammed. Labor operation 18-19-07-C2 (Inspect and Reprogram) is used for this step. Any issues during flashing should be reported to the Helpdesk.
  4. DTC Clearance: After reprogramming, any DTCs that may have been set in other modules due to the process will be automatically presented by the wiTECH application and should be cleared.

Required Tools or Parts

Technicians will require a wiTECH or Equivalent Scan Tool to perform the diagnosis and reprogramming procedures.

Owner Action

If you own a 2026 Jeep Compass and experience a Jeep Compass depleted battery or a no-start condition, you should contact your authorized Jeep dealership. They can verify if your vehicle is affected by TSB 08-048-26 and perform the necessary software update for the Drivetrain Control Module.

Warranty Policy

All repairs performed under TSB 08-048-26 are reimbursable within the provisions of the vehicle's warranty. The applicable failure codes for claims are RF (Required Flash - RSU) or CC (Customer Concern).
